Predicted to enable ribosomal large subunit binding activity and ribosome binding activity. Predicted to be involved in several processes, including assembly of large subunit precursor of preribosome; regulation of translation; and ribosome biogenesis. Predicted to be located in cytoplasm; lamin filament; and nucleoplasm. Predicted to be part of preribosome, large subunit precursor. Predicted to be active in cytosol and nucleolus. Orthologous to human EIF6 (eukaryotic translation initiation factor 6). [provided by Alliance of Genome Resources, Apr 2022]
